Life and Death in Rikers Island Medicine Hospital-Acquired Condition Alerts)Description Shining a light on the deadly health consequences of incarceration. Kalief Browder was 16 when he was arrested in the Bronx for allegedly stealing a backpack. Unable to raise bail and unwilling to plead guilty to a crime he didn't commit, Browder spent three years in New York's infamous Rikers Island jailtwo in solitary confinementwhile awaiting trial.
